Tom more food for thought.

From Internet magazine and courtesy of International Data Corp. here's the growth
rates

---------------------------------

1) for network computers:

1996 - 706 million dollars
2000 - 15,440 million dollars

Growth rate - 116%

----------------------------------

2) for servers:

1996 - 2,200 million dollars
2000 - 13,150 million dollars

Growth rate - 56%

---------------------------------

3) for personal computers:

1996 - 5,511 million dollars
2000 - 16,200 million dollars

Growth rate - 31%

---------------------------------

These are global rates. Remember Peter Lynch's adage about playing growth indirectly. Well APCC is an indirect route to play this growth. Profitable niche. International areas need the protection. Servers and Symmetra fit nicely.
